TechArt Noselift System for Boxsters and Caymans!
This just in! TechArt's Noselift system is now compatible with the Boxster and Cayman chassis. In conjunction with TechArt's popular coil-over suspension, drivers have the ability to lift the front axle 60mm to clear driveways and steep inclines. Controls mount cleanly into the dome light on the Boxster and aside the hand brake on the Cayman. Let me know what you guys think.

It's a hydraulic system that operates automatically through the push of a button. It takes just 6 seconds to reach full lift and does it under complete silence. You can also use the noselift while moving (up to 37mph). This allows you to prep for an incline and will automatically lower itself once you've accelerated past 37mph. Due to it's compact size, you won't lose any luggage compartment space either.

It's actually a full coilover suspension front/rear. The noselift system hydraulically controls hats on the front suspension that increase the ride height. There's no loss of performance from running the noselift system versus the PASM-compatible coilover suspension by itself.
